SignupLogin

Auth Kit

Username or Email and password

Either Use your unique username or email and password to to authenticate.

One Time Password

A 6 digit one time password can be sent to your email to authenticate.

Anti Brute Force & Spam

Only 5 failed login attempts are allowed every 15 minute, same goes with sending OTP to avoid spam.

Account Linking

Registered through social accounts? No problem, after using this on signup you will be asked if you want to login through username or email with password afterwards

Multi Factor Authentication

Using Authenticator App like bitwarden, google authenticator or 1password. Email OTP is enabled upon registration.

Sudo Access Mode

When doing an important action and you didn't recently login. a dialog will display to confirm your identity.

Passkeys

WIP.
Will be implemented according to the W3C Recommendation